  1. When local daylight time was about to reach. Sunday, November 6, 2022, 2:00:00 am clocks were turned backward 1 hour to. Sunday, November 6, 2022, 1:00:00 am local standard time instead. Sunrise and sunset were about 1 hour earlier on Nov 6, 2022 than the day before. There was more light in the morning and less light in the evening.

  3. Nov 6, 2022 · Change. Daylight Saving Time Starts: Sunday, March 13, 2022. Daylight Saving Time starts on the second Sunday of March for the United States. Clocks are turned forward one hour from 2 am to 3 am. Clocks are changed forward one hour from local standard time to local daylight time. Daylight Saving Time Ends: Sunday, November 06, 2022.

  5. In spring the clock advances from the last moment of 01:59 am to 03:00 am DST. In autumn the clock jumps backward from the last moment of 01:59 am DST to 01:00 am.
